    What Is Commercial Intelligence?

    Commercial intelligence is the systematic analysis of live business signals — hiring patterns, funding events, leadership appointments, operational changes, and financial filings — to identify companies entering buying windows.

    A buying window is the period following a significant business change when a company is most likely to evaluate new suppliers, make purchasing decisions, and engage with relevant vendors. Companies don't buy on a fixed schedule — they buy when circumstances force or enable a decision.

    Commercial intelligence platforms like BuyingWindow monitor millions of these signals continuously, using AI to detect the combinations that indicate genuine opportunity. The output isn't a list of companies — it's an intelligence report explaining exactly why a specific business needs your services right now.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    What is commercial intelligence?

    Commercial intelligence is the systematic analysis of live business signals to identify companies entering buying windows — periods when purchasing decisions are most likely. It combines data from hiring activity, financial filings, leadership changes, and operational signals to give B2B sales teams a timing advantage over competitors.

    What is the difference between commercial intelligence and sales intelligence?

    Sales intelligence traditionally focuses on contact data, company firmographics, and static enrichment — who works where. Commercial intelligence focuses on timing and context — when a company is entering a buying window and why. Commercial intelligence is dynamic and signal-driven; sales intelligence is typically static and data-driven.

    How does commercial intelligence improve sales performance?

    Commercial intelligence improves sales performance by replacing volume-based outreach with precision-timed engagement. When sales teams know which companies are actively entering buying windows — and why — they can prioritise their pipeline, personalise their outreach, and engage at the exact moment a prospect is most receptive. This typically results in significantly higher response rates and shorter sales cycles.

    What data sources does commercial intelligence use?

    Commercial intelligence platforms like BuyingWindow analyse multiple data streams: job posting patterns (indicating investment areas), Companies House filings (growth, restructuring, financial health), news and press releases (strategic intent), LinkedIn activity (leadership changes, company growth), contract databases, and regulatory filings. The value comes from analysing these sources in combination, not in isolation.

    Is commercial intelligence the same as business intelligence?

    No. Business intelligence (BI) refers to internal data analysis — dashboards, reports, and metrics about your own operations. Commercial intelligence is external and market-facing: it analyses signals from other companies to identify commercial opportunities for your sales team. BI helps you understand your own business; commercial intelligence helps you understand which other businesses are ready to buy from you.
